Citing a short story from a website isn't too complicated. Just make sure to include the essential details such as the author, the title, the website address, and when it was posted. The way you organize these details depends on the citation format you're using, whether it's APA, Chicago, etc.
First, you need to find the author's name, the title of the short story, the website name, and the date of publication. Then, follow a specific citation style like MLA or APA to format the information.
Well, to cite a short story from a website, start by noting down the URL, the publication date if available, and the author's name. Different citation styles have different rules, so make sure you know which one you should follow. For example, in MLA, you might write it like this...
